linux软件包被废除,Linux基础1.0

1、什么是TCP/IP?

TCP/IP是最广泛支持的通信协议集合,包括大量Internet应用中的标准协议,支持跨网络架构、跨操作系统平台的通信。

2、主机与主机之间通信的三个要素?

IP地址(IP address)  子网掩码(subnet mask)  IP路由(IP router)

3、IP的分类?

A类:1 ~ 127      网+主+主+主

B类:128 ~ 191    网+网+主+主

C类:192 ~ 223  网+网+网+主

D类:224 ~ 239  组播

E类:240 ~ 254  科研

4、配置IP地址方法?

自动获取(DHCP)和手工配置

5、子网掩码作用?

标识IP地址的网络位与主机位,用1代表网络位 用0代表主机位

6、如何查看IP地址?

ipconfig(Window) ifconfig(Linux)

7、DNS服务器作用?

解析域名,将域名解析为IP地址

8、主机之间ping不通原因?

线路或硬件问题,防火墙未关闭,不在同一网络中

9、Linux系统时间的起点?

1970-1-1

10、版本号构成?

主版本.次版本.修订号 (次版本为奇数为开发版,为偶数为稳定版)

11、Window和Linux默认的文件系统?

Window:NTFS、FAT

Linux:ext4(RHEL6),xfs(RHEL7),swap(虚拟内存)

12、/dev/sda5的含义?

SCSI接口的硬盘,第一块硬盘,第5个分区

13、查看当前系统版本、内核版本、主机名、CPU处理器

cat /etc/redhat-release

uname -r

hostname

lscpu

14、ls命令后面可以跟的选项及含义?

-l:长格式显示详细信息

-h:提供易读单位

-d:当前目录

-A:隐藏文件

15、查看/etc/passwd文件8-12行?

head -12 /etc/passwd | tail -5

16、Linux默认解释器?

/bin/bash

17、卸载挂载点显示目标忙的原因?

目前正在挂载点没有退出

18、列出/dev/目录下tty20至tty30的设备文件?

ls /dev/tty{2[0-9],30}

ls /dev/tty{2?,30}

19、创建多层目录要加什么选项?

-p

20、将/opt/student文档改名为/opt/test

mv /opt/student /opt/test

21、将/home/、/etc/group、/etc/shadow等文档复制到/opt/下

cp -r /home/ /etc/group /etc/shadow  /opt/

22、如何取消强制覆盖的提示?

命令前加\

23、vim的三种模式?

命令模式、输入模式、末行模式

24、设置永久别名的配置文件(全局和局部)

/etc/bashrc  /root/.bashrc

25、软件包管理选项

rpm -q 查询软件包是否安装

rpm -ivh 安装软件包

rpm -e 卸载软件包

rpm -qa 查询所有已安装的rpm包

26、yum仓库配置文件和各字段?

/etc/yum.repos.d/*.repo

[  ] name  baseurl  enabled  gpgcheck

27、 yum的各选项含义

yum -y install 安装

yum remove 卸载

yum clean all 清空缓存

yum repolist 列出仓库信息

yum search 搜索软件包名

28、下载文件到/opt/下并命名为test1.txt

wget 软件包URL网址 -O /opt/test1.txt

29、配置网络参数(主机名student.cn、IP地址192.168.4.10、子网掩码、网关192.168.4.254、DNS地址)

配置文件:/etc/sysconfig/network-scripts/ifcfg-eth0

echo student.cn > /etc/hostname

nmcli connection modify eth0 ipv4.method manual ipv4.addresses 192.168.4.10/24 connection.autoconnect yes

nmcli connection up eth0

echo nameserver 192.168.4.254 > /etc/resolv.conf

30、用户基本信息存放文件,七个字段?

/etc/passwd 用户名:密码占位符:uid:gid:用户描述信息:用户家目录:解释器

31、添加新用户zhangsan(uid=1001,家目录/opt/zs,附加组tarena,没有登陆系统权限

useradd -u 1001 -d /opt/zs -G tarena -s /sbin/nologin zhangsan

32、更改zhangsan登陆密码为123456

echo 123456 | passwd --stdin zhangsan

33、将lisi用户加入stugrp组,将harry从stugrp组删除

gpasswd -a lisi stugrp

gpasswd -d harry stugrp

34、将/home/目录和/opt/目录压缩到/mnt/下的file.tar.gz文件,然后解压到/usr/local/下

tar -zcf /mnt/file.tar.gz  /home /opt/

tar -xf /mnt/file.tar.gz -C /usr/local

35、时间同步的安装软件包、配置文件、系统服务名

chrony  /etc/chrony.conf  chronyd

36、周期性计划任务

分 时 日 月 周

crontab -e 编辑

crontab -l 查看

crontab -r 清除

37、显示/etc/login.defs有效信息(去除注释,去除空行),保存到/opt/下,命名为2.txt

grep -v ^# /etc/login.defs |  grep  -v  ^$  >  /opt/2.txt

38、修改/nsd/test文件的属主为lisi,属组为stugrp

chown lisi:stugrp  /nsd/test

39、设置lisi对/nsd09具有读和执行权限

setfacl -m  u:lisi:rx  /nsd09

40、LDAP步骤

(1.安装一个sssd软件,与LDAP服务器沟通

[root@server0 ~]# yum -y install sssd

(2.安装图形的工具authconfig-gtk,图形配置sssd

[root@server0 ~]# yum -y install authconfig-gtk

(3.运行图形的工具进行配置

[root@server0 ~]# authconfig-gtk

选择LDAP

dc=example,dc=com            #指定服务端域名

classroom.example.com        #指定服务端主机名

勾选TLS加密

使用证书加密: http://classroom.example.com/pub/example-ca.crt

选择LDAP密码

(4.重起服务

[root@server0 ~]# systemctl restart sssd  #重起服务

[root@server0 ~]# systemctl enable sssd    #设置开机自启动

(5.验证:

[root@server0 ~]# grep  ldapuser0  /etc/passwd

[root@server0 ~]# id  ldapuser0

41、find后面的常用选项及含义

-type  类型(f文件、d目录、l快捷方式)

-name  "文档名称"

-size  +|-文件大小(k、M、G)

-user  用户名

find  /boot/ -size +300k  -exec cp  -r  {}  /opt  \;

find  /root -name "nsd*" -type f  -exec cp  -r  {}  /opt  \;

find /etc/ -maxdepth 2  -name  "*.conf"

find /var/log -mtime +90  #过去时间90天之前

find /var/log -mtime -90  #过去时间90天之内

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值